mc服务器如何双核

fiy 其他 120

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要使Minecraft服务器能够双核运行,需要进行一些设置和调整。以下是一些步骤和建议:

    1.确保你的服务器支持多核处理器:首先,确保你的服务器硬件支持多核处理器。检查你的服务器厂商提供的文档或与他们联系以确认。

    2.安装和优化Java:Minecraft服务器是基于Java开发的,因此要充分利用多核处理器,需要安装和优化Java。确保你使用的是最新的Java版本,并对Java进行适当的调整和优化,以便充分发挥多核处理器的性能。

    3.分配CPU核心:为了使Minecraft服务器能够双核运行,你需要将不同的Minecraft服务器实例分配给不同的CPU核心。这可以通过编辑服务器启动脚本或使用特定的启动参数来实现。具体的操作方法和参数设置可以根据你使用的服务器软件和操作系统来确定。

    4.优化插件和MOD:如果你在Minecraft服务器上使用了大量的插件和MOD,那么你应该优化它们以充分利用多核处理器。一些插件和MOD可能已经针对多核处理器进行了优化,但其他一些可能需要额外的设置和调整。

    5.监控和调整性能:一旦你将Minecraft服务器设置为双核运行,你应该监控服务器的性能并进行适当的调整。使用服务器监控工具来监视CPU利用率、内存使用情况和网络流量等指标,并根据需要进行调整以提高服务器性能。

    总结起来,要使Minecraft服务器能够双核运行,你需要确认服务器硬件支持多核处理器,并进行适当的设置和优化。分配CPU核心、优化Java和插件、监控和调整性能都是实现这个目标的重要步骤。记住,每个服务器和配置都可能存在不同,因此你需要根据自己的情况进行合适的调整和优化。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将Minecraft服务器设置为双核运行,您需要执行以下步骤:

    1. 检查您的服务器硬件:首先,确保您的服务器有两个或以上的核心。如果您的服务器只有一个核心,您无法将其设置为双核运行。您可以通过查看服务器的技术规格或联系服务器供应商来确认核心数。

    2. 安装Java:Minecraft服务器需要Java来运行。请确保您的服务器已安装Java。您可以从官方Java网站上下载并安装最新版本的Java。

    3. 启动参数中设置多个线程:在启动Minecraft服务器时,您可以在启动参数中设置多个线程。您可以通过创建一个启动脚本或修改服务器管理面板中的设置来完成此操作。在启动参数中,您需要使用"-XX:ParallelGCThreads=N"选项,其中N是您希望使用的线程数量。请注意,线程数应小于或等于服务器的核心数。

    4. 监控服务器性能:一旦设置双核运行,您应该监控服务器的性能,确保运行顺利。您可以使用一些服务器管理工具或插件来监控服务器的CPU使用率、内存使用情况和网络流量等。

    5. 优化服务器设置:除了将服务器设置为双核运行外,您还可以采取其他优化措施来提高服务器性能。例如,您可以调整服务器的视距,减少插件和模组的数量,优化网络设置等。

    需要注意的是,将Minecraft服务器设置为双核运行并不一定能够提升性能。其效果取决于您的服务器硬件和配置以及服务器负载情况。因此,在进行任何更改之前,建议您备份服务器文件,并在更改后进行测试和评估。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在搭建Minecraft服务器时,如何使用双核处理器来优化性能是一个常见问题。下面就是一些方法和操作流程,介绍如何使用双核处理器来提高Minecraft服务器的性能。

    1. 确认服务器硬件
      首先,确保服务器硬件支持双核处理器。大部分现代服务器都配备了多核处理器,但有些旧的或低端的服务器可能只有单核处理器。要确认是否有双核处理器,可以通过以下步骤:
    • 登录到服务器操作系统
    • 打开任务管理器或系统监视器
    • 查看处理器信息,确认是否显示了两个或更多的核心
    1. 配置服务器操作系统
      确保服务器操作系统正确地配置和管理双核处理器。通常,现代操作系统会自动识别和利用多核处理器。在某些情况下,可能需要手动配置操作系统以最大化利用双核处理器。这可能涉及到修改内核参数或启用特定的功能。具体配置方法可以参考操作系统的文档或相关资源。

    2. 分配Minecraft服务器的CPU核心
      一旦确认服务器具备双核处理器,并且操作系统已经正确配置,下一步就是分配Minecraft服务器的CPU核心。这可以通过运行多个实例来实现,即将Minecraft服务器运行在不同的CPU核心上。

    为了实现这一目标,需要进行以下步骤:

    • 将Minecraft服务器文件夹复制多份,并为每个实例分别命名。
    • 修改每个实例的配置文件,确保它们在不同的端口上运行。
    • 启动每个实例,让它们分别占用不同的CPU核心。

    在Linux操作系统上,可以使用taskset命令来设置进程的CPU亲和力,从而将进程绑定到特定的CPU核心上。例如,要将进程绑定到第一个核心上,可以使用以下命令:
    taskset -c 0 java -jar minecraft_server.jar

    在Windows操作系统上,可以使用任务管理器或第三方工具来设置进程的CPU亲和力。具体方法可以参考相关资源或工具的文档。

    1. 监控和优化性能
      一旦完成双核处理器的配置,就可以开始监控和优化服务器的性能。以下是一些常见的操作:
    • 使用性能监控工具,如htop、top等,来监视服务器的CPU使用情况。
    • 根据服务器负载情况,调整Minecraft服务器实例的数量和分配的CPU核心。
    • 调整服务器的其他配置参数,如内存分配、视距设定等,以获得最佳性能。
    • 如果需要更高级的优化,可以考虑使用插件或模组,如Spigot或Paper,来进一步优化服务器性能。

    总结:
    使用双核处理器来优化Minecraft服务器的性能可以通过正确配置和管理服务器操作系统来实现。配置操作系统以支持多核处理器,并将Minecraft服务器的实例分配到不同的CPU核心上,可以提高服务器的并发处理能力。同时,监测和优化服务器的性能也是提高性能的关键。希望这些方法和操作流程对您有所帮助!

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部